Current and resistance in a parallel connection

Principle

In households, electrical devices are often connected in parallel to different sockets of the same electric circuit. The total current and the total resistance of the circuit can be predicted from the partial resistances.

Current and resistance in a series connection

Principle

Various components in a circuit can be connected in series. The total resistance and the total current can be calculated from the partial resistances of the components.

Bridge rectifiers

Principle

Rectifying circuits with a single diode can only utilize one half wave of alternating current. The bridge rectifier solves this problem by having four diodes connected such that a current path is open for each halfwave.
